Abstract

The invention provides an intelligent charging device convenient operation system. The intelligent charging device convenient operation system comprises a charging device main body (1) and a battery box interface box (2). The battery box interface box (2) is embedded in the charging device main body (1). The intelligent charging device convenient operation system also comprises an operation interface (4) and a control system. The control system is electrically connected with the operation interface (4) and the battery box interface box (2). The invention is suitable for surgery electric systems.

Description

Intelligent charger portable operating system
Technical field
The present invention relates to medical instruments field, particularly medical power systems art.
Background technology
Along with people's quality of life and improving constantly treatment requirement, bone surgery treatment is more and more paid attention to by doctor and patient.The object of bone surgery treatment is to rebuild to greatest extent and restore funcitons.According to the principle of AO/ASIF, Fracture internal fixaiion builds on a kind for the treatment of comprehensively on the accurate reduction of the fracture, the stable blood fortune of fixing, retaining bone as far as possible, early function sexuality basis.In bone surgery treatment, bone saw for medical purposes and medical bone drill are the most frequently used instruments, the dynamical system of bone saw for medical purposes and medical bone drill adopts rechargeable battery pack, realize recycling by discharge and recharge, and the dynamical system adopted at present arranges unreasonable, charging operations step is various, requires higher, affect charging device result of use to user.
Summary of the invention
In order to solve the problem, first object of this practicality is to provide a kind of intelligent charger that is efficient, handled easily.
The intelligent charger portable operation system technology scheme that this practicality provides:
A kind of intelligent charger portable charging system, comprise charging device main body (1), battery case interface arrangement (2), described battery case interface arrangement (2) embeds in charging device main body (1), it is characterized in that: also comprise operation interface (4), control system, this control system is electrically connected with described operation interface (4) and described battery case interface arrangement (2).
As preferably, described operation interface (4) has touch-screen.
As preferably, described operation interface (4) is provided with and runs key and stop key.
As preferably, described battery case interface arrangement (2) has many groups, embeds side by side in described charging device main body (1).
As preferably, the side of described charging device main body (1) is provided with louvre (5).
As preferably, the both sides of described charging device main body (1) are provided with hugging (6).
As preferably, the both sides of described charging device main body (1) are provided with handle.
The Advantageous Effects of this practicality:
The present invention adopts one-touch touch screen operation interface, behaviour operating personnel can operate touch operation screen, system identifies type and the current power state of battery to be charged automatically, operator confirms battery charging parameter, system is in charged state and battery charging complete prompting, dial except battery case again and insert new battery case, safer, reduce the operate miss of operator.Electrode slot and metal electrode suitable, during charging, directly metal electrode is inserted groove, charges electricity, directly extract, very convenient use.Can carry out the charging of many Battery packs, efficiency improves several times than charging one to one simultaneously.Charging device main body is provided with louvre, is distributed by the heat produced in time in charging process, safer.The both sides of charging device main body arrange hugging or handle, are convenient to equipment moving.

Embodiment
Below in conjunction with specific embodiment, set forth this practicality further.Should be understood that these embodiments are only not used in the scope limiting this practicality for illustration of this practicality.
Embodiment 1
As shown in Figure 1, Figure 2, Figure 3 shows, a kind of intelligent charger portable charging system, comprise charging device main body 1, battery case interface arrangement 2, described battery case interface arrangement 2 embeds in charging device main body 1, also comprise operation interface 4, control system, this control system is electrically connected with described operation interface 4 and described battery case interface arrangement 2.In the present embodiment, described operation interface 4 adopts touch-screen, and is provided with operation key and stop key.Control system, according to the parameter situation such as voltage, electric current of charging, by information transmission on operation interface 4, indicates the operation that operating personnel carry out out or stop.Operating personnel can operate touch operation screen, system identifies type and the current power state of battery to be charged automatically, operator confirms battery charging parameter, system is in charged state and battery charging complete prompting, dial except battery case again and insert new battery case, safer, reduce the operate miss of operator.The battery case interface arrangement 2 that the present embodiment adopts has many groups, embeds side by side in described charging device main body 1.And the side of charging device main body 1 is provided with louvre 5; The both sides of described charging device main body 1 are provided with hugging 6.
